The MY26 Kawasaki Z900 has officially arrived in India, revving back into the scene with a competitive ₹9.99 lakh (ex-showroom) price tag. This marks the return of the legendary 948cc naked streetfighter under the ₹10 lakh bracket, reaffirming Kawasaki’s hold on the middleweight performance segment. The new model blends refined Sugomi styling with premium electronics and subtle but meaningful performance tweaks.

Updated Design and Engine Performance

At its core, the MY26 Kawasaki Z900 continues with the same proven engine configuration while refining its delivery and dynamics:

  • Engine: 948cc, liquid-cooled, inline-four
  • Power: 125 PS @ 9,500 rpm
  • Torque: 98.6 Nm @ 7,700 rpm
  • Kerb Weight: 212 kg (down 1 kg from MY25)

Electronics and Riding Aids

Carrying over the comprehensive electronics suite introduced in the 2025 model, the MY26 Z900 ensures a feature-rich ride with class-leading safety and versatility:

  • 5-inch TFT color display with smartphone connectivity
  • IMU-based Kawasaki Traction Control (KTRC)
  • Kawasaki Cornering Management Function (KCMF)
  • Electronic Cruise Control
  • Power Modes and Integrated Riding Modes (Sport, Road, Rain, Rider)
  • Dual-direction Kawasaki Quick Shifter (KQS)

Price Strategy and Market Positioning

Kawasaki has strategically priced the MY26 Z900 to stay below the crucial ₹10 lakh mark, despite the increased GST rates on >350cc motorcycles. The move sharpens its value proposition in the litre-class naked segment.

ModelVariantOld Ex-showroom Price (₹)New Price (₹)Drop (₹)Drop (%)
Kawasaki Z900 (MY26)Standard10,18,000 (MY25 post-GST)9,99,00019,000~1.87%

Competitive Edge

In the middleweight naked segment, the MY26 Kawasaki Z900 now competes head-on with models like the Triumph Street Triple RS, Honda CBR650R, and Ducati Streetfighter V2.

  • Z900 (₹9.99 lakh) undercuts the Honda CBR650R by over ₹1 lakh.
  • Delivers power and torque levels comparable to more expensive European rivals.
